Dumli-ing Falls | Nueva Vizcaya

It is the highest waterfalls in Nueva Vizcaya called as Dumli-ing located in Brgy. Balete, Kayapa, Nueva Vizcaya and is among the top ten highest falls in the Philippines with an approximate elevation of 98 meters.

Name Origin
Long ago, the falls became the playground of spirit people known in Ikalahan - Kalanguya word as "Bi-biao".  The waterfalls were surrounded by variety of healthy plants and the rock was covered by purely green moss during the stay of the spirit people as described by locals who witnessed it. 

Until one day, the spirit people appear in a dream of a man named as "Pilusan".  One of them introduces himself as "Dumli-ing" and informed the man that they are among the spirits who live in the falls. But after the 1990's earthquake, the spirit people departed from the falls and their presence can't be perceived by the locals anymore. Their existence in the falls is no longer present up to this time. Locals believed that the spirit people - "Biao" relocated to another place.

Elevation
According to the locals from the previous survey conducted by Cagayan Valley Tourism Office of its elevation is 120 meters, but after years and years of unexpected erosion and falling rocks filling its basin. Now, it barely stands at 98 meters measured by the Tourism Office of Bayombong, Nueva Vizcaya.

Reaching Brgy. Balete, Kayapa
There are two options to reach Brgy. Balete, you will either commence from Ambaguio or Benguet: 

Ambaguio. Trekkers/Hikers venturing Mt. Pulag via Ambaguio trail will eventually pass through or see the Barangay of Balete. After passing the Haday village, ascending to the top of Upper Napo, and dwelling on a hike from Napo to Balete where the falls is located. 

Brgy. Balete is evident from the top of Mt. Pullol. The mountain lies at the boundary of Ambaguio and Kayapa. Normal trek from Ambaguio trail to Dumli-ing will take long hours or even days, depends on the pace

Benguet. Upon entering the road heading to Balete, Kayapa from Sitio Bahbahlak, you will feel the ambiance of the mossy forest that surrounds the whole mountain and sometimes ringed by fogs, which is very common in the area. 

Along the road, you will see a number of vegetable garden and Kaingin which is mainly the source of income of the locals

It’s a one lane road establish in year 2014 which made possible for public or private transportation such as motors and jeepney to enter the area. Approximate time will vary on the transportation used; normal trip will take you 1-3 hours to reach the Barangay of Balete. 

Nearing Barangay Balete, you will gaze the Dumli-ing waterfalls, the noise and sound of water as it drops to the ground is like a gong that vibrates in your ears that exhilarates oneself to sojourn the falls. 

Hike to Dumli-ing Falls
The hike to the falls will take you 30 – 45 minutes long from Barangay Hall (Registration Point). Normal hikers would take about an hour while fast hikers will have for half hour or less. Trails is much established but not cemented, though it needs maintenance in case the grasses grow.

The trail is narrow, be vigilant on the cliff until reaching the viewpoint of the falls. Descending upon, you will eventually see a blockage (gate) of animals and a houses that will be passed through.

Based on the condition of the falls (not yet improve), swimming and picnicking is not available for the time being. Yet, Sightseeing and falls viewing is the best thing to do at Dumli-ing falls. 

How to get there
Ride a bus or van heading to Baguio, and look for a jeep going to sitio Bahbahlak, Brgy. Bashoy, Kabayan, Benguet at Dangwa Bus Station. Once you’re in Sitio Bahbahlak, hire a single motor ride to Balete, Kayapa, Nueva Vizcaya. 

Alternatives. If you have contacts to any driver/s (single motor), inform them about your meet up (Possible meetup will be at Gurel, Bokod, Benguet or at Sitio Bahbalak) so that they will fetch you for a ride to Balete, Kayapa, Nueva Vizcaya. 

Note: Ranger Station of Mt. Pulag is situated at Sitio Bahbahlak, Brgy. Bashoy, Kabayan, Benguet.

Travel Note
  • After registration, if you are not familiar with the trail, hire a guide or locals who will accompany you on your descend to the falls. 
  • All fees (registration/guide) will serve as donation for the improvement of the trail/falls. 
  • Camping in the falls is not allowed.
